Nokia takes on Huawei in connecting laptops

on 21:34 comments (0)

Tarmo Virki, Reuters

Published: Friday, December 12, 2008

HELSINKI - The world's top mobile phone maker Nokia plans to tap the surging market for connecting laptops to wireless networks taking on market leader Huawei Technologies, its senior official said.

Nokia will start to ship its first Internet stick in early 2009, aiming to benefit from its know-how and experience in developing 3G technologies, Tapio Markki, vice president for hardware platform components at Nokia, told Reuters.

"Leveraging these capabilities, we believe we are well-positioned to become one of the winning providers for HSPA modem solutions. The market for HSPA modems is expected to grow very rapidly during the coming years," Markki said.

Nokia declined to comment on the price of the device -- which uses HSPA, a super-fast 3G technology -- saying it would be sold mostly through operators and bundled with services.

Strategy Analytics said it expects the global market for so-called "dongles" -- external USB modems and PC cards -- to grow to 26 million units next year from 20 million this year.

"In particular European operators, such as Vodafone, are aggressively promoting and subsidizing dongles right now, because they are seen as a secondary device that provides additional revenues for carriers beyond a traditional handset," said Neil Mawston from Strategy Analytics.

Nokia tried to enter into the business of connecting laptops to wireless networks in late 2006 when it said it had developed an embedded 3G module for notebook computers, which Intel agreed to sell as part of its next-generation Centrino Duo mobile technology platform.

But in early 2007, Nokia and Intel made a joint decision to cease cooperation on the connectivity module.

HP - HDX16-1010EA review

on 06:01 comments (0)


desktop replacement multimedia laptop (03/12/2008)

With all the talk and media interest in netbook computers, you'd be forgiven for thinking that nobody is interested in anything with a higher spec. This is far from the case and high-end multimedia laptops can be all you need forcomputing and entertainment.

HP's HDX16 is a smaller screen version of its 20-inch, all-singing, multimedia laptop from last year. This new machine, with its titanium-coloured case and designer key lines in charcoal and silver, looks exclusive and even the HP badge on the lid lights up in an Apple-ish kind of way. This attention to style is apparent when you open the case, too, as the 16-inch, widescreen LCD has no bezel and a flat, hard acrylic face for its bright, needle-sharp display.

The full-size keyboard, with separate number pad, has metallised key tops and the beautifully engineered touchpad has a polished steel surface, which is delightful to use. To the right of the touchpad is a fingerprint reader, so there's no excuse for leaving accessible data on a bus, train or bar-stool. Behind the keyboard is a polished metal strip containing touch controls for audio, so you can slide your finger left and right to change volume or tone.

On that note, Altec Lansing has engineered the audio and has managed to give this laptop passable sound, rather than the scratchy, bass-free noises most notebooks make.

Round the HDX16's edges are all the normal sockets, such as USB and FireWire, but there's also gigabit Ethernet, HDMI video (as well as VGA) and eSATA and a five-in-one card reader. There's even a slot to take the miniature remote control, provided for Windows Vista Media Centre and HP's own MediaSmart application. Works, Norton Internet Security and a two-month Microsoft Office trial are also bundled.

A Blu-ray drive, which can also handle dual-layer DVD and CD writing, provides external storage and inside there's a 320GB hard drive and 4GB of main memory. The processor is a 2.26GHz Core 2 Duo and this is partnered by an NVIDIA GeForce 9600M GT GPU, driving the 1920 x 1080 pixel, HD 1080p-compatible display.

All this hunky hardware works together to provide a fast machine, scoring over 3,800 on PCMark Vantage and over 1,250 on 3DMark Vantage, on the Performance setting. The 3DMark figure is not as high as we'd expect, though in practice most current games run at reasonable frame rates, if you cut back on the screen resolution.

Dell's Economical Vostro A860 Now Available In the US

on 08:49 comments (0)




Once only available in "emerging markets," this $379 Vista capable laptop has finally meandered its way into the US.
The Dell Vostro A860 is a 15.6" laptop that has been available to emerging markets in Asia, Africa, Europe and Latin America since late August, but has only now arrived Stateside.
At the starting price you'll get an Intel Celeron M (upgradable to Dual Core), a GM965 Chipset with GMA X3100+ integrated graphics, 1GB RAM (upgradable to 2GB), a 120GB HDD (upgradable to 160GB), and a DVD/CD-RW or a DVD burner, which, again, is an upgrade. That's how you know it's a Dell.
The display has a resolution of 1366x768 and with the standard 4 cell battery it weighs in at a moderate 5.4lbs, although we shudder to think of the battery life. Still, can't beat that value.
